Graveside service: 2 p.m. Monday in Everman Cemetery, Everman. Visitation: 1 to 5 p.m., with the family present from 3 to 5 p.m., Sunday.
Karen was a member of the Eastern Star in Stephenville. She was much loved and admired by family and friends and will be greatly missed.
She was preceded in death by her sister, Lynne Harvell; daughter, Denise Langford; and son, Nicky Freeman.
Survivors: Former husband of many years, Johnnie Freeman of Fort Worth; son, Alan Freeman of Dublin; stepson, Scott Jones and wife, Terry of Alvarado; daughter, Dawn Nelms and husband, Roy of Grand Prairie; brother, Sam Brown of Farmers Branch; grandchildren, Jonathon, Candice, Lance, Stacy and Christopher.
